Save type has nothing to do with what you see on screen. If you try to save your progress, that is where save type matters.As for the viruses...

Q: In Megaman Starforce:Leon/Dragon/Pegasus, why can't I see monsters on No$gba?A: Use No$gba v2.6.

I assume the same applies in Starforce 2, since it uses the same engine.Save type to use is Flash 2Mbit (I believe no$gba calls it Flash 0.5MB). When you change the save type, remember to go back into the menu and save the configuration.
